Magnetic Personality

That thing that lies at the center of your personality, the core housing what you know as your identity, your self, the part of you that's remained unchanged and unchanging, is like a magnet. Connected to it, layer upon layer, rests a lifetime's accumulation of what you've come to know about yourself. The mass around the periphery a shifting representation of who you've been over time transformed through choices both of unconscious assumption and explicit decision.

In your better days of housekeeping, digging deeper, it can be the most difficult of tasks trying to identify what should be removed or replaced. Those things closest to the core so much harder to separate as they become nearly indistinguishable from that nucleus to which they are attached. Though, in truth, their location often is a matter not of their importance, but solely of the longevity over which you've allowed them to lay undisturbed.
